file.c: Optimize `rb_file_dirname_n` fixed costs
- `str_null_check` was performed twice, once by `FilePathStringValue`
and a second time by `StringValueCStr`.
- `StringValueCStr` was checking for the terminator presence, but we
don't care about that.
- `FilePathStringValue` calls `rb_str_new_frozen` to ensure `fname`
isn't mutated, but that's costly for such a check. Instead we
can do it in debug mode only.
- `rb_enc_get` is slow because it accepts arbitrary objects, even immediates,
so it has to do numerous type checks. Add a much faster `rb_str_enc_get`
when we know we're dealing with a string.
- `rb_enc_copy` is slow for the same reasons, since we already have the
encoding, we can use `rb_enc_str_new` instead.
